Marcelo Bielsa : 3-3-1-3

Bielsa's 3-3-1-3 is an inherently attacking formation that aims to take the game to his opponents, press and defend high up the pitch, and stretch the play as wide as possible when in possession. His back three and the defensive midfielder are essentially the four defensive-minded players, whilst the two wing-backs surge forward whenever possible, trying to create overloads against opposition full-backs, and also venturing into more central attacking positions to provide a goal threat.

The forward trio stretch the opposition defence and the wingers start from very wide positions to open up gaps that are exploited by the defensive forward and the advanced playmaker.


Training

Match training - Defensive positioning always.

General training - Tactics/very high - during pre-season swap it every week with team cohesion


Opposition instructions

Strikers - Tight mark always
